352 SPECIAL OPERATIONS WING CAMPUS RELOCATION DEVELOPMENT USER REQUIREMENT DOCUMENTS

Project Details

CLIENT
Air Force Special Operations Command

LOCATION
Spangdahlem Air Base, Germany

 

Woolpert prepared 12 user requirements documents (URDs) for Air Force Special Operations Command (AFSOC), Installations and Mission Support Directorate, Engineering Division, Plans and Programs Branch. These URDs quantify requirements, provide design guidance and justify funding for future facility acquisitions within the AFSOC military construction (MILCON) program.

The URDs were prepared using project management plans; data gap identification; project definitions; site, floor plan and elevation drawings; and space analysis. Deliverables included DD Form 1391s, with associated parametric cost estimates that accurately reflected the latest mission and facility requirements.

Woolpert also developed conceptual designs for the site development and infrastructure; airfield pavements; two- and three-bay hangars; parachute drying tower; and facilities for operations, special tactics and special operations support squadrons. The 416,600 square feet of facilities and 90,000 square yards of airfield pavement reviewed in the URDs are intended to support 10 Osprey aircraft, 10 MC-130J aircraft and over 1,000 associated personnel.
